Is the PAM spray okay to use with Iguanas? I ended up just coating her in mineral oil and so far it seems to have worked. I tried soaking in the water and dish soap but she wasn't having any part of that. Suprisingly she was okay with the mineral oil. I took her cage apart and soaked everything in a bleach and water solution. It has been about three days and I still don't see mites. I tried a couple of the reptile sprays for mites and they only seemed to work for a day or so and then I would find mites crawling on her again. I went ahead and treated my snake racks with the PAM. I have checked my snakes several times and haven't seen any mites but they are in the same room as her. I can't figgure out where she could have gotten mites. Thanks for your help!
